Last week we signed onto a letter from 23 organizations calling for greater funding for the Maryland Meals for Achievement (MMFA) program. Schools participating in MMFA provide breakfast in the classroom each morning to every student, regardless of family income. The MMFA program improves academic performance, reduces behavior problems, and increases students attention spans.

Sometime this week we expect the Comptroller to announce the results of the FY 2012 closeout. Fiscal year 2012 ended June 30th. The Comptroller also maintains an archive of previous closeout reports.

  • Capital Budget Subcommittee of the House Appropriations Committee meets for a briefing on the new youth detention center report. Public testimony is not usually accepted for briefings. However, written public testimony will be accepted for this briefing. Submit 40 copies no later than August 28, 2012 by 3pm. The briefing starts at 10am in room 120 of the House Office Building, Annapolis.
